Hon'ble Alok Kumar Verma, J.

This Criminal Writ Petition has been fil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India to issue a writ of certiorari to quash the impugned First Information Report No.0086 of 2022, registered with Police Station Gadarpur, District Udham Singh Nagar for the offence under Section 420 of IPC, Section 63 and Section 65 of the Copyright Act, 1957.

2. Heard Mr. Anant Dhaka, the learned counsel for the petitioner and Mr. V.S. Rathour, the learned A.G.A. for the State.

3. During the arguments, the learned counsel appearing for the petitioner submitted that this writ

petition may be disposed of with a direction to the concerned Station House Officer, Police Station Gadarpur, District Udham Singh Nagar/respondent no.2, and the Investigating Officer to follow the judgment of the Hon'ble Supreme Court, passed in 'Arnesh Kumar vs. State of Bihar and Another', (2014) 8 SCC 273, before proceed to arrest the petitioner.

4. The learned counsel for the State has no objection on the above submission of the learned counsel for the petitioner.

5. In view of the above, this Criminal Writ Petition No.988 of 2022 is disposed of with a direction to the Station House Officer, Police Station Gadarpur, District Udham Singh Nagar/respondent no.2, and the Investigating Officer to follow the guidelines formulated by the Hon'ble Supreme Court in 'Arnesh Kumar vs. State of Bihar and Another', (2014) 8 SCC 273.
